![]() Hey guys i just wanted everyones opinion on how i should run my lighting setup as in how long the lights should be on and such.
I have a 72" coralife fixture, 3-250 wattMH, and 4 36 power compacts(atinics) What should my lighting schedual be. I have 1 bubble tip anenome, and 3 turbo snails and 4 chromis,(starter crew) The tank has been running for just over 2 weeks, i have started to get a layer of greenish brown slime on some of the rocks to. Any help would be appericiated. Thanks Josh

![]() Hey Josh, your MH should only run 6 hrs continuios as I have been told. As in my case for an example my lights run as follow's:
Actinics 9 am - 9pm Fiji Purple 10am - 8 pm 10000K 11am - 7pm 3 - 250 MH 14000K 1pm - 6pm Moon light's 9pm - 6am This seem's to work for me, you could run your MH for a couple hrs & have them shut off for a couple hr's, but have them on for when you are around the most for viewing. Greg

You will get varied ideas on time, what Greg is doing isn't wrong either. The longer you leave the lights on the more growth time you can get for the coral. Maybe you can start with 6 hours and increase over time to see how the coral and fish react. If you start seeing adverse affects, then back off one increment. Anemones can be picky and generally do best when added to an established tank, typically 6mos or longer. I realize others may disagree and have had success, but 2 weeks is definitely too early for an Anemone. As for lighting, I'd recommend anything from 6-8hrs hours for MH. Most corals can only use so much photoperiod for useful growth from articles that I've read. There is a thread on RC with a lot of people who tested/testing the theory of shorter photoperiod to yeild greater results in growth.
